Black woman



Black woman of polished skin
Portraying a glimpse of paradise
Her black skin sparkles like a diamond
Her beauty lies right in her eyes
5. Ancient woman of nature's colour
She is powerful and dreaded
Soaring far as an eagle, Roaring loud as a lion,
10. Black woman, Pure hands
Her great hands sharper than spears
Slay heads in fierce battles
With her delicate hands She fight wars thicker than rocks
15. Dark woman, Black gold
On her thighs stands her children,
Great nations of long time race
Beneath the root of her hairs are
Great lands of comfort and peace
20. Black woman, Dark mother
Strapped on her back is
her giant female
An infant but yet full of power
Fighting wars with
The sounds of her voice
25. Black woman, Dark beauty
Her shadows heals the broken mind
Her savory lips kiss the stars
Shinning brightness into her being
Black woman, Dark lady
30. Great woman of
Inestimable value.

About this poem

The beauty, strength, greatness of Africa.
